U.S. Jobless Claim Hold Gold and Silver Prices Down
GOLD
Data from the U.S. Labor Department revealed the weekly jobless claims increased to 196,000, up 13,000 from the previous week’s 183,000. Gold prices have seen another dip even with the U.S. Dollar weakening. At 11am PT today, Gold is trading at $1,860 per ounce, down $17.
SILVER
Similarly to Gold, Silver is experiencing a price drop after statements from the Federal Reserve invigorated concerns of more increases in interest rates to come. At 11am PT today, Silver is trading at $21.95 per ounce, down $0.40.
